Weather Service issues Fire Weather Watch for Central Coast, 9pm Oct 4th thru 6pm Oct 6th

SANTA BARBARA, Ca. October 2, 2013 –The National Weather Service has issued a Fire Weather Watch for the California Central Coast including the Santa Barbara front country and mountains. During this time, temperatures and winds are expected to increase and relative humidity is expected to decrease. A Red Flag Warning may develop as a result of the predicted weather pattern.

Fire Weather Watch Duration: 9 pm Friday October 4th through 6 pm Sunday October 6th.

A strong offshore flow is predicted to produce winds of 15 to 25 mph with gusts to 35 mph. The predicted relative humidity is expected to be in the single digit range.

The combination of very low relative humidity and gusty offshore winds will bring a significant threat of critical fire weather to the area. Extremely dry fuel conditions already in place would allow for rapid fire growth potential during this wind event.

Fire Weather Watches are typically issued 12 to 72 hours in advance of potential critical fire weather conditions.

During this time, the Santa Barbara County Fire Department will evaluate the need for increased staffing levels.
